What is the first layer of the subtle body referred to as?

The first layer of the subtle body is referred to as the pranic sheath. This layer is associated with the vital energy or life force known as prana, which is essential for all bodily functions and vitality. The pranic sheath is primarily focused on the flow of energy throughout the body, connecting physical existence with the inner life force.

This layer plays a critical role in yogic philosophy and practice, as it emphasizes the importance of breath and energy management in yoga. Practitioners often engage in breathing techniques (pranayama) to enhance their pranic energy, facilitating deeper states of meditation and physical wellness. Understanding this layer provides a foundational perspective on how energy affects both the physical and spiritual aspects of being.

While the other options represent different sheaths of the subtle body, they occur at deeper layers or levels of consciousness. The intellectual sheath relates to the mind's functioning and higher cognitive processes, the bliss sheath pertains to a state of ultimate happiness and contentment beyond the physical and emotional experiences, and the mental sheath encompasses thoughts and emotions. Each of these layers builds upon the foundational layer of the pranic sheath, highlighting the integral role of vital energy in the overall structure of the subtle body.
